ASA Recruitment is seeking caring, dependable individuals to support local authority care homes in Kirkcaldy. We offer regular shifts with flexibility and stability for those seeking a work-life balance. Weekend availability is highly desirable as many services require consistent cover across weekdays and weekends.
The Role:
- Deliver hands-on personal care and support to residents.

How to prepare for a job interview at beBeeCare
✨Know Your Role
Before the interview, make sure you understand what a Home Care Support Worker does. Familiarise yourself with the responsibilities, such as delivering personal care and supporting residents. This will help you answer questions confidently and show that you're genuinely interested in the role.
✨Show Your Caring Side
In this line of work, empathy and compassion are key.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you've demonstrated these qualities. Whether it's through previous jobs or personal situations, sharing these stories can really resonate with the interviewer.
✨Flexibility is Key
Since weekend availability is highly desirable, be ready to discuss your schedule openly. If you can work weekends or have flexible hours, let them know! This shows that you're committed to meeting the needs of the service and can adapt to their requirements.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team dynamics, training opportunities, or how they support their staff. This not only shows your interest but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
